Papicha (2019)
The world needs movies like Papicha
This film draws its power from its ability to make people feel oppression from the perspective of the main character, Nedjma. The film oscillates between the daily life of a carefree young woman and the situation in Algiers at the time of radicalization in the 90s which does not correspond to the mentality of young girls of the time. All the remarks and attacks that Nedjma endures throughout the film show to what extent women of the time were oppressed by terror and indoctrination. A dramatic film in which we can salute the talent of Lyna Khoudri and Shirine Boutella. A Great movie which help me to understand this part of history.
Don't Worry Darling (2022)
Is this the real barbie feminist film?
This film made me strongly think of the film Barbie, the look of the characters, the fact that they're living in a "perfect" world, even the houses which are adjoining in a circle like in the film Barbie is very disturbing and make me think that if barbie had really actually been a feminist film then it would have looked like this movie. At the same time as the character, we discover what is going on behind the mask of this perfect life and the film takes us down a path that we did not imagine at the beginning. Certainly a few elements could be explored in greater detail to make this film a perfect one, but in terms of having a good time watching a film that makes you think, the bet is won. In terms of acting, we cannot deny the very good performance of Harry Styles who must have perfectly embodied all the facets of his character.
